Output 84d94e4df548a64fd927ef520c4b74d4fb41fe1e0661518fb1b16aff9df8dd4c:1

value
990469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6c3623443cab3a2e806322a149ec6c901ff4c52 OP_EQUAL
address
3JMNxwwgk8oCLDSsAyyscuxXVCQqgsJ41b
transaction
84d94e4df548a64fd927ef520c4b74d4fb41fe1e0661518fb1b16aff9df8dd4c
spent
true